SOLD Large French 18th Century Painted Trumeau Mirror with Giltwood Musical Trophy

SOLD A large French Louis XVI period painted trumeau mirror from the late 18th century, with carved giltwood musical trophy. Born in France during the reign of King Louis XVI, this exquisite trumeau mirror features in its upper section a carved ribbon-tied musical trophy symbolizing the Liberal Arts, surrounded by olive branches. The side posts are accented with pilaster-reminiscent motifs while the lower section presents gilded waterleaf and beaded motifs framing the central mirror plate. This giltwood décor stands out beautifully on the soft-colored background, making this late 18th century French Louis XVI period painted and gilded trumeau mirror a great focal point to enliven any wall.
Place of Origin: France
Period: 18th Century
Dimensions: 66.25" H x 2" D x 46" W
